Swain, David Lowry
lawyer, jurist, college president, governor, author, was born Jan. 4, 1801, near Asheville, N.
C. In 1824 he was elected to represent Buncombe county, N. C., in the house of commons of the state. In 1831 he was appointed judge of the supreme court; from 1832 to 1835 was governor of the state.
From that time until his death he was president of the university of North Carolina. He published British Invasion of North Carolina; and other works. He died Sept. 3, 1868, in Chapel Hill, N. C.
